Releasing data really works, Part III: The RSPB 2013 Big Garden Bird Watch released data by county, listing bird counts for each in order of abundance. I converted these into one row of bird types per county.



I then took the OS Opendata Boundary Line polygon shape files, and conflated the legal entities into a simple county maps where counties existed, augmented with district and metro polygons where they didn't.

I then posted the cleaned up OS Counties and RSPB 2013 data on the ShareGeo site as simple shape files, and the same county and bird count data on the ArcGIS Online as layer packages. I then published it on my private GIScloud:
